I'm looking to purchase a HPP3 part # 30010 that suppose to be for a 2001 LS1 z28/Pon. T/A. Well my engine in my truck is 2000 LS1 Pon. T/A and the HPP3 unit calls for part # 390753, does anyone know if this unit # 30010 will work on my engine ????? The owner of the unit says his z28 is a 2000 with LS1 and it worked fine, unit has been reset to factory. Any help ????

that's a tuff one, i guess the only ppl that would know is hypertech. I know on the ls1edit side, you have to be careful as to which file you flash pcms with, just becuase they're the same year, it may have a different version, which will destroy the pcm is flashed with the wrong version.
